The Importance of a Car Auto Locksmith

A car auto locksmith specializes in handling various lock-related problems for cars. They are geared up with the knowledge and tools required to manage a large range of problems, from key replacements to lock rekeying and high-security lock setups. Here are a few key reasons that having a dependable car auto locksmith near you is important:

  1. Emergency Situations: Being locked out of your car is a typical emergency situation, and a locksmith can provide immediate assistance.
  2. Security: A professional locksmith can ensure that your vehicle's security is not compromised, whether by creating new keys or upgrading your lock system.
  3. Cost-Effective: Attempting to fix lock concerns by yourself can cause harm and greater expenses. A locksmith can often offer a more budget friendly and effective service.
  4. Convenience: Locksmiths offer mobile services, coming to your place to deal with issues without the requirement to tow your vehicle.

Common Services Provided by Car Auto Locksmiths

Car auto locksmiths provide a range of services to help with various lock-related issues. Here are a few of the most typical services:

  1. Lockout Assistance: If you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can rapidly and securely gain entry for you.
  2. Key Duplication: If you've lost your keys, a locksmith can develop a duplicate from your spare or from scratch using your vehicle's VIN number.
  3. Key Replacement: For circumstances where your keys are lost and you do not have a spare, a locksmith can create a new set of keys.
  4. Lock Rekeying: This service includes altering the tumblers in your car's locks to accept new keys, frequently utilized when you've recently acquired a used vehicle or wish to improve security.
  5. High-Security Locks: Some locksmiths focus on installing high-security locks to provide additional protection versus theft.
  6. Transponder Key Programming: Many modern-day vehicles use transponder keys, which need programming. An experienced locksmith can guarantee your brand-new key is effectively programmed.
  7. Ignition Repair: Issues with the ignition cylinder can also be resolved by a locksmith, consisting of repairs and replacements.
  8. Remote Keyless Entry Repair: If your remote keyless entry system is not working, a locksmith can identify and fix the issue.

FAQs About Car Auto Locksmiths

Q: How do I understand if a locksmith is genuine?

  • A: Check for certification and licensing, checked out online reviews, and request for referrals. A genuine locksmith will be transparent about their credentials and services.

Q: Can a car auto locksmith aid with a non-functioning keyless entry system?

  • A: Yes, lots of car auto locksmith professionals are equipped to diagnose and repair problems with keyless entry systems, consisting of battery replacement and sensing unit repair.

Q: How much does it cost to get a car lockout service?

  • A: The cost can differ depending upon the service, time of day, and area. On average, a car lockout service can cost between ₤ 50 and ₤ 100.

Q: Do car auto locksmith professionals provide mobile services?

  • A: Yes, most car auto locksmiths use mobile services, enabling them to come to your location and fix your lock issue without the requirement to move your vehicle.

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the original?

  • A: Yes, a locksmith can create a brand-new key utilizing your vehicle's VIN number and a code book. Nevertheless, this process may take longer and cost more than duplicating an existing key.

Q: What should I do if I'm locked out of my car?

  • A: Stay calm, call a reliable car auto locksmith, and have your vehicle info ready. Avoid trying to force entry, as this can damage your car's locks and increase costs.

Tips for Avoiding Car Lockout Emergencies

While emergency situations can be unforeseeable, there are actions you can take to lower the likelihood of being locked out of your car:

  • Keep a Spare Key: Always have a spare key kept in a safe and available location.
  • Examine Your Keys Before Locking: Make it a habit to examine that you have your keys before locking your car.
  • Set Up a Car Tracker: Consider installing a car tracker that can help you find your keys if you lose them.
  • Regular Maintenance: Regularly check your car's locks and keyless entry system to guarantee they are functioning properly.
